Q
How does arbitration differ from mediation?

Ask a Defamation Law lawyer in Stirling

Arbitration involves a binding decision by an arbitrator, while mediation seeks a mutually agreed resolution facilitated by a mediator.;Mediation is usually less formal and focuses on negotiation and settlement.
